Overview

Featuring a restaurant and luggage storage, the 3-star Shakespeare Hotel Auckland lies at a distance of 0.7 km from Aotea Square. This comfortable hotel features Wi-Fi, provided in public areas.

Location

Nestled in the very heart of Auckland, near a train station, the property is just a minute's drive from Viaduct Harbour. Guests can visit NIWA - National Institute of Water and Atmospheric Research, located nearly 5 minutes' walk from the hotel, and Albert Park, which is just 0.8 km away. The accommodation is also quite close to Viaduct Harbour. There is Queen Street approximately a 5-minute ride away, and SkyCity Terminal bus station a short way from The Shakespeare Hotel.

For those travelling from afar, Auckland airport is 26 minutes' drive away.

Rooms

This Auckland property welcomes guests to 10 non-smoking rooms. Some of them come with free wireless internet and a television along with coffee/tea making equipment. The smoke-free hotel also features an electric kettle and a fridge. Offering dryers for guests' comfort, the en suite bathrooms are fitted with a walk-in shower.

Eat & Drink

Residents can have breakfast in the restaurant. The lounge bar on-site has its own a billiards table and WiFi. Choose from an unlimited choice of Japanese dishes at Masu which is only 5 minutes' walk away.

Leisure & Business

The Shakespeare has a sun deck, various recreational opportunities, and a lending library for guests' enjoyment.

    Location Age - a historic building

    Three steep flights of stairs to room without a lift. Given my dubious health a major disadvantage which will deter me from using it again. This info should be on the website so people booking are pre-warned. Staff did offer help with bag but even unladen the stairs were a struggle. Would recommend BUT only with provision of warning about stairs and no lift.

    The only good thing I can say is the location is good for Queen's Street & downtown, and good hot water pressure in the shower.

    The restaurant did not appear to be open, I would struggle to call it a "boutique hotel". They do not brew their own beer on site (as told by a barman), the "front desk" is the bar which is open all night. The room was tired, the wardrobe is a shop clothes rail, the "ensuite" bathroom is an after thought addition ( an adult could not sit properly on the toilet as it was so close to the shower cubicle). Only 3 channels were clear on the tv (no remote), No decent curtains to shut out the street lights. As soon as the staff find out who I was, the next statement was $99 please. I do not believe the advertising for this accommodation on this web site is accurate. I think I could get a better room for a cheaper price with good location.
